How do we know that God delivers us from our troubles?

We know God delivers us from troubles as Psalm 107 illustrates His repeated actions of rescue and salvation.

Throughout Psalm 107, the narrative repeatedly emphasizes that when the people of God cry out in their trouble, He responds with mercy and delivers them from their distress. This pattern is a testament to God's unwavering faithfulness to His people. It shows that He is always ready to intervene when called upon. The recurring theme of deliverance serves as both assurance and encouragement, providing a foundation for faith in God's saving power.
Scripture References: Psalm 107:6, 13, 19, 28
